Not sure if this is why others are saying it's a terrible design, but this is why I'm not going for it - although the more I think about it these are problems I could work around if I built a bigger table around it...

It has too small of a ceramic area around the fire pit - you can't set your beer or put your feet up on it.

It's too short of a height, at 18" you're talking about ankle height and it won't make a good centerpiece table.

The base of the table is open, that's where your propane tank would go, under the table, and it's just going to be an eyesore detracting from the idea behind the table. Actually I'm not even sure if it's tall enough or if there is enough clearance for a propane tank under the table - you can see in the pictures there's a gas line setting up a nice trip hazard.

If you were looking to DYI the price is a good price for a burner (they are surprisingly expensive on their own) and you could build this into a larger table that solves the problems (either having the control side on the edge of your build or re-positioning them).
